Vaughan holds off Barrie to advance to Semi-Finals

In a quarterfinal battle between two wild card teams, the Vaughan Kings would reign supreme as they advance to the semifinals after beating the Barrie Colts 3-2.
With a goals from Stefan Chukharev (2, 3) and Carter Kostuch (5), Vaughan held a 3-0 lead till late in the second. Owen Bruining (2) would get the Colts on the board to cut the Kings lead down to two heading into the intermission.
2008-born Logan Hawery (4) scored on the power play late in the third to draw his team to within one, but Vaughan’s strong defence didn’t waiver to hold on for the win.
In a close game that took a full team effort, Chukharev spoke about his team’s performance saying, “That was a big win for us, we are trying to win it all and it’s taking a full team effort from everyone to do it.”
With his two goals in the game, Chukharev earned BARDOWN Player of the Game honours for Vaughan, while Hawery received the honours for Barrie.
Owen Bruining (2-4–6) had six points and underage talent Logan Hawery (4-1–5) had five points to lead Barrie in scoring, as the Colts finish with a record of 3-2
Vaughan will now take on the OMHA champion Peterborough Petes in the semifinals tonight at 8:00pm.
